Libwww vs. Nicola Pellow

libwww ('''Lib'''rary '''W'''orld '''W'''ide '''W'''eb) is a modular client-side web API for Unix and Windows. Nicola Pellow was one of the nineteen members of the WWW Project at CERN working with Tim Berners-Lee.

Line Mode Browser

The Line Mode Browser (also known as LMB,, WWWLib, or just www) is the second web browser ever created.

MacWWW

MacWWW, also known as Samba, is an early minimalist web browser from 1992 meant to run on Macintosh computers.

Robert Cailliau

Robert Cailliau (born 26 January 1947) is a Belgian informatics engineer and computer scientist who created the first web browser for the Mac.

WorldWideWeb

WorldWideWeb (later renamed to Nexus to avoid confusion between the software and the World Wide Web) was the first web browser and editor.
